Key Features to Look For
When sifting through used dump trailers by owner for sale in Sierra Leone, several essential features warrant careful consideration:
Feature | Importance |
---|---|
Weight Capacity | Ensure the trailer can handle your specific load requirements without compromising safety. |
Condition | Inspect for rust, wear and tear, and mechanical integrity, as they directly affect longevity. |
Hydraulic System | Verify the efficiency of the hydraulic system, as it propels the dumping mechanism. |
Tires | Assess tire condition, tread depth, and whether replacement is necessary for optimal performance. |
Braking System | Ensure that the braking system is responsive and meets safety regulations. |
Detailed Inspection Checklist
For a thorough assessment of potential trailers, consider the following checklist before finalizing your purchase:
Frame and Structure
- Check for signs of corrosion or significant wear.
- Look for any misalignments that could affect towing comfort.
Hydraulic Functionality
- Test the hydraulic system to ensure smooth operation.
- Look for leaks in hydraulic hoses and seals.
Floor Condition
- Inspect the floor for damage or signs of excessive wear.
- Evaluate whether it is capable of carrying the intended payload without risk.
Lights and Wiring
- Verify that all lights function correctly.
- Check the integrity of wiring and connections.
Tires and Suspension
- Examine tire pressure and overall condition.
- Inspect the suspension for wear to ensure a stable and comfortable towing experience.
Documents and Verification
Purchasing used dump trailers by owner requires careful documentation verification. Ensure that the following documents are available:
- Title Deed: Confirms ownership and ensures that the seller has the right to sell the trailer.
- Maintenance Records: Gives insights into the upkeep and past repairs, indicating how well the trailer was taken care of.
- Inspection Certificate: If applicable, validate that the trailer meets local regulatory requirements.

Cost Factors
Understanding the cost breakdown is pivotal when considering used dump trailers by owner for sale in Sierra Leone. Here are critical elements affecting pricing:
- Condition of the Trailer: The more pristine the trailer, the higher the price; however, minor defects can lead to discounts.
- Age and Model: Older models may be cheaper but could lack modern features that improve efficiency and safety.
- Load Capacity: Trailers designed for heavier loads generally command higher prices due to their robust construction.
Expected Price Range
- Entry-Level Trailers: $5,000 – $10,000
- Mid-Range Trailers: $10,000 – $20,000
- High-End Models: $20,000 and above
Trailer Type | Estimated Price Range |
---|---|
Light-Duty Dump Trailers | $5,000 – $10,000 |
Medium-Duty Dump Trailers | $10,000 – $15,000 |
Heavy-Duty Dump Trailers | $15,000 – $25,000 |

FAQs
1. What is the average lifespan of a used dump trailer?
A well-maintained used dump trailer can last between 10 to 15 years, depending on usage and care.
2. Can I finance a used dump trailer purchase?
Yes, many financial institutions offer financing options specifically for heavy equipment, including used dump trailers.
3. How do I maintain a used dump trailer?
Regular inspections, lubrication of moving parts, prompt repairs, and cleaning after use are crucial maintenance practices.
4. Are there warranties available for used dump trailers?
Some sellers may offer limited warranties for used dump trailers; however, it’s essential to clarify the terms before purchase.
